Item number382pgcm14


Item number177pag26


Item number177pag27


Item number109sup101


for details

Item number3591581112


Item number683700519


Item number190valve34


Out of Stock

Enter an email to be notified when product is back in stock:

Item numberhp13908


Item numberhp1178202


Item numberhp10300


Item number3591581124


Item numberhpgr19


Item numberhp213542


Item numberhpp5045642


Rated 5 out of 5 stars

Item number3591581125


Item numberhp60148101


Item numberhp21880303


Item numberap521117


Item numberhp1176014


Item numberhp2500141b


Item numberhp00719221


Item numberhp00961329


Item number3591621156


Item number2401089100


Rated 5 out of 5 stars

Item number2401089101


Item numberhp100110857


Item numberhpat2e18063


Item numberap511386